This Bourgogne Rouge from Serafin Père et Fils 2012 presents a graceful weave of dark cherry and forest floor, framed by gentle oak that lends both depth and refinement. The structure is poised with fine-grained tannins and a lingering note of earthy spice, the type of Burgundy that rewards patience and quiet contemplation.

From the Archive
The Bourgogne Rouge vines all adjoin appellation Gevrey. Elevage 50% new oak, 50% one vintage used.
